Trump: The United States will continue to control Iran's assets

BlockBeats message: On May 28, U.S. President Donald Trump said that the United States will continue to control Iran’s assets. Iran has begun providing us with what we want; if things do not go smoothly, U.S. Secretary of Defense Hegseth will carry out the task. We can end the war with Iran very quickly, and we may even have to do so. However, I don’t think we need to.
